A catalogue of Dryinidae of Mozambique, with description of a new species(Hymenoptera: Chrysidoidea)

Abstract

A new species of Dryinidae, Gonatopus chiruanus, is described from Mozambique, Niassa Province, Mecanhelas District, Entre-Lagos. The male of Gonatopus bekilyanus (Benoit, 1954) is described for the first time. An updated checklist of Dryinidae of Mozambique is presented. With the above new records, 45 species of Dryinidae are now known from Mozambique. New records from other countries are also provided.
